Output 6fefd5314c8a56c38a46af195e52eb6c675ae496edf8a273496a4ecf87ccb741:1

value
19314400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 142f968883930cce9a7276c79eeb9120e9fc8754 OP_EQUALVERIFY OP_CHECKSIG
address
12qjXJzetL3Yp4kPwNBU77eGByAxgMA3V6
transaction
6fefd5314c8a56c38a46af195e52eb6c675ae496edf8a273496a4ecf87ccb741
confirmations
454949
spent
true